Why Finding a “Buyer Agent Near Me” Matters When You Are in Defence
Buying a home while serving in defence is very different to buying one as a civilian. Postings can change every few years. This makes it hard to know where “home” should be or how long you will stay. Partner careers, access to childcare, proximity to schools and the impact on kids’ routines all add extra pressure to get the location and property choice right. The Department of Defence notes that moving due to posting can disrupt children’s schooling, friendships and routines and may cause anxiety, which is why planning and support matter so much for defence families.
When you type “buyer agent near me” into a search bar, what you are really looking for is someone who is on your side only. A buyer’s agent is a licensed professional who represents the buyer, sources suitable properties and negotiates with selling agents on your behalf. For defence families, the right agent combines this expertise with a clear understanding of local markets and defence entitlements so every decision supports both your service and your long term plans.

2. Negotiating So You Do Not Overpay in a New Posting Location
Walking into a new market, it is easy to pay too much simply because you do not know what “normal” looks like. A good buyer’s agent gives you clear pricing guidance based on recent sales, local demand and how the property really compares to others in the area. They help you structure offers and contract conditions that protect your family, rather than just suiting the seller’s timeline.
When emotions run high or you are under time pressure, they also handle the back and forth with selling agents – from managing bidding and counteroffers to pushing back on tactics designed to rush you. This keeps negotiations calm and factual so you are not paying a premium just to get a deal done before your next posting date.

5. Managing Contracts, Timelines and Due Diligence
Once your offer is accepted, the paperwork and checks can feel just as stressful as the search. Working with the agent you found by using a “buyer agent near me” query now makes total sense. They help coordinate key steps like building and pest inspections, strata reports and other due diligence so potential issues are uncovered early. They work alongside your conveyancer and lender to keep everyone on the same page.
Crucially for defence families, the “buyer agent near me” that you found will also keep contracts and timelines aligned with posting dates, leave windows and family logistics. Instead of juggling emails between different parties, you have one point of contact making sure deadlines are met. This reduces last-minute surprises and gives you more confidence heading into settlement, even when the rest of life is moving fast.
